Kenya, Somalia, Ethiopia launch project to reopen borders

Two women walk near the Ethiopian border crossing on the outskirts of Dollow, Somalia, Sept. 20, 2022. [VOA]

A new project aims to reopen the official border crossings between Kenya, Somalia, and Ethiopia, which have been partially or fully closed in recent years due to security issues.

Speaking Thursday in the border town of Mandera during the launch, Kenya's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ua said the project will improve socio-economic development between the three countries.
